Web3与智能合约交互:两者之间的区别你知道吗?

          时间:2026-04-18 18:20:03

          主页 > 加密圈 >

            什么是Web3?

            好吧,先聊聊Web3。大家都知道,Web1.0就是静态页面,像是在网上看个报纸;Web2.0则是社交媒体时代,让我们有了互动,能发动态、评论、点赞等等。Web3就是这一切的升级版,讲的是去中心化。简单说,它希望让用户掌握自己的数据,不再依赖于那些大公司。而且,Web3的核心就是区块链技术,利用它来交易、转账、甚至管理身份。听上去是不是很酷?

            智能合约的基础

            再说说智能合约。想象一下,智能合约就像是自动化的小机器人。你跟它说:“只要A满足了条件,就给B转钱。”当条件一达成,它就会自己执行这个操作。这样就不需要信任第三方了。这种合约是存储在区块链上的,所以它不仅不容易被篡改,还能百分之百透明。

            Web3和智能合约的关系

            那么,Web3和智能合约有什么关系呢?可以说,Web3是一个大框架,而智能合约则是这个框架里的一个重要功能。Web3不仅仅是关于智能合约的,它还包括如何让我们与区块链进行交互。如果把Web3比作一个智能手机,那么智能合约就是这个手机上那些好用的APP,很多时候你是通过这些APP来体验手机的。

            交互方式的不同

            说到交互,Web3和智能合约的方式可完全不同。Web3的交互是通过钱包应用、DApp(去中心化应用)来完成的。你可以用钱包来交易、访问各种具有区块链特性的服务。想象一下,你想去参加一个线上漫展,得先连接你的钱包,然后签名确认才能入场。这个过程简单吗?有点小复杂,但长远来看,它让我们能掌握更多信息。

            而智能合约的交互是更加具体且程序化的。如果你要执行某个合约,就得调用特定的智能合约地址,传输数据,这涉及到相应的代码和算法。你需要有一定的技术背景来理解这些操作,特别是当你想参与一些复杂的合约时。我有个朋友,他不太懂代码,但还是为了买一个NFT学了一把,哎,那看得我心疼,因为他搞得一团糟。不过,最后他还是搞定了,虽然经历了一些“小波折”。

            安全性和透明度

            当我们谈到安全性和透明度时,Web3和智能合约也展现出了不同的特性。Web3本身是去中心化的,而这意味着更少的中介和对用户隐私的保护,你的数据不会被大公司滥用。但是,由于很多DApp的安全性依赖于开发者的代码,因此,若代码有漏洞,用户就可能面临风险。

            而智能合约则在于它的不可篡改性和透明性。你能公开查看代码、逻辑和历史交易记录,这就让每一笔交易都有迹可循。想象一下,一笔交易做完后,任何人都可以验证这笔交易是按照合约来执行的,真是太安心了。

            用户体验的差异

            要是聊用户体验,我觉得Web3的方式相对来说,更容易理解。虽然有些操作复杂,但许多DApp都尽量做得用户友好,比如像MetaMask这样的钱包,使得用户可以方便地管理他们的加密资产。但是如果你要深入了解智能合约的底层逻辑,可能需要一段时间的学习和摸索,尤其是对那些没有技术背景的人。

            我有个朋友,他特别喜欢玩DApp,几乎每天都在钻研各种项目。起初他不懂,甚至对一些术语感到困惑,像是“gas费”、“矿工”、“区块链”这些,但后来慢慢掌握了。毕竟,做投资嘛,总得了解清楚。他说一旦理解了这些,他就能选择更好的项目,过得可开心了。

            总结Web3与智能合约的差异

            简单来说,Web3是一个大的生态,而智能合约则是其中的重要组成部分。Web3让用户能够以去中心化的方式与各种区块链服务进行互动,而智能合约则提供了一套自动化的流程来确保合约条款的执行。

            前景展望

            未来,Web3和智能合约的交互方式会怎样变呢?我认为,随着技术的发展和用户教育的普及,这两者的距离会越来越近。许多开发者正在努力让Web3的体验更加流畅,智能合约的复杂度也会逐渐被简化。道理很简单,谁不想让用户更方便、操作更简单呢?

            总之,Web3和智能合约有着不同的理念和目的,但在未来的区块链发展中,二者必将携手共进,不断演化出新的可能。如果你对这个领域感兴趣,不妨多多关注,那些新兴的技术和应用套路真的会让你开眼界。

            谈谈个人感受

            说到这,我自己也在慢慢学习这些知识,刚开始我也是一头雾水。但后来通过看视频、听播客和各种社区的讨论,逐渐明白了很多东西。有些朋友就热衷于投身于这个领域,因为他们看重它的颠覆性和未来潜力。我也这样想,还是需要与时俱进。

            其实,Web3和智能合约的交互不仅仅是技术,更是未来生意的机会。想象一下,所有的资产、所有的交易,都可以在去中心化的环境中自由流动,没有人可以随意干扰,这是一种怎样的可能!

            所以,要勇敢去了解它,加入这个充满想象的世界。就像我对朋友说的,虽然路途可能有点颠簸,但如果我们不去尝试,真的会错过很多精彩的机会啊!